Understanding Pond Liners

What are pond liners?

Pond liners are impermeable membranes that are used to line the bottom and sides of a pond, preventing water from seeping into the surrounding soil. They create a barrier that keeps the water contained within the defined boundaries of your pond.

Factors to consider when choosing a pond liner

When selecting a pond liner, it is important to consider various factors to ensure it meets your specific requirements. Here are a few key factors to keep in mind:
  1. Size and shape of the pond: Measure the dimensions of your pond accurately to determine the right size and shape of the liner you need. Remember to account for any irregularities or unique features in the pond design.
  2. Durability: Consider the expected lifespan of the liner and its ability to withstand external factors such as UV rays, temperature fluctuations, and potential punctures.
  3. Flexibility: A flexible liner is easier to install, especially if your pond has curves or irregular shapes. It also allows for natural movement of the pond as water levels fluctuate.
  4. Cost: Pond liners vary in price depending on the material, size, and brand. Consider your budget and weigh the cost against the durability and lifespan of the liner.

Sealing the Deal: Pond Liner Seals

Sealing the pond liner is an essential step to prevent water leakage and ensure the longevity of your pond. Here are two common methods used to seal pond liners:

1. Mechanical Seals

Mechanical seals involve the use of additional materials and techniques to secure the pond liner in place. These methods typically include:
  • Underlayment: Underlayment materials, such as geotextile fabric or old carpet, are placed beneath the pond liner to provide cushioning and protection against sharp objects in the soil.
  • Anchor pins: Anchor pins or stakes can be used to secure the pond liner at the edges or corners, preventing it from shifting or moving.
  • Rocks and gravel: Placing rocks or gravel along the edges of the pond liner can help anchor it in place and create a more natural-looking transition from the pond to the surrounding landscape.
